I just wanted to ask as well if getting a locker, can you get say 4.10's (front and back) instead of just re-gearing? In my head (y'all know how weird that place is) the pumpkin get's changed when buying a locker so is that the go to save on double buying? Sorry if this doesn't make sense.

The 4.10s are the re-gearing of the ring and pinion inside of the pumpkin. The locker is the replacement for the carrier within the diff. So you wont have to double buy anything, rather just replace everything within the differential.

BigOne I got the locker and it is modified and ready to go in. Going to put it in while I have the diffs out for re-gearing. I'm leaving the front open since it looks like you've done fine with an open front and a locked rear.

Can't say on the suspension spacers yet but I have a day off of work this week and will try and get them done then. Might need to do limit straps to keep the balljoints happy but will run them a while and see first.
 






Limithing strap will help. Gears help big time you will realy love the locker. How much for the gears to be installed it cost me 2000$ for gears and install total worth every cent!
 






Gears and master kits cost about 800. Install should be a couple hundred an axle.

I already did the modding to make the aussie fit. Center gap is only .130 though which they say is too tight in the manual but everyone I talk to has the same issue on the 8.8 axle and they just run it and it works fine.
